On timelike surfaces in Lorentzian manifolds

We discuss the geometry of timelike surfaces (two-dimensional submanifolds) in a Lorentzian manifold and its interpretation in terms of general relativity. A classification of such surfaces is presented which distinguishes four cases of special algebraic properties of the second fundamental form from the generic case. Closed Timelike Curves

In this paper, we explore the possibility that closed timelike curves might be allowed by the laws of physics. A closed timelike curve is perhaps the closest thing to time travel that general relativity allows. Quantum fields on timelike curves

A quantum field Φ(x) exists at an event x ∈ M of space-time (M, g) in general only as a quadratic form Φ(x). Only after smearing Φ(x) with a smooth test function f we get an operator Φ(f). In this paper the question is considered whether it is possible as well to smear Φ(x) with a singular test function T (i.e. test distributions) supported by a smooth timelike curve γ. Computability Theory of Closed Timelike Curves

We ask, and answer, the question of what’s computable by Turing machines equipped with time travel into the past: that is, closed timelike curves or CTCs (with no bound on their size). We focus on a model for CTCs due to Deutsch, which imposes a probabilistic consistency condition to avoid grandfather paradoxes.
